This policy exists to prevent misuse of qrkarekod.com and forms an integral part of the Terms of Service.

A QR code does not reveal its destination in advance. People scanning it do not know where they will end up. Protecting that trust is a core responsibility, which is why these rules exist.

1. Prohibited uses

Fraud and phishing — impersonating banks, public authorities, couriers or any organisation to collect credentials, passwords or card details; directing to fake payment pages; collecting information under the pretence of fake campaigns or prizes; producing codes intended to be pasted over genuine QR codes in public places.

Malware — directing to addresses hosting viruses, trojans, ransomware or spyware, or to pages that download files without consent.

Unlawful content — child sexual abuse material of any kind; terrorist financing or propaganda; trade in drugs, weapons or people; content relating to the catalogue offences listed in article 8 of Turkish Law No. 5651; illegal gambling.

Infringement of rights — copyright, trademark or patent infringement; defamation and insult; violation of privacy or publication of images without consent.

Hate and violence — hate speech on the basis of race, ethnicity, religion, gender, sexual orientation, disability or similar characteristics; incitement to or glorification of violence; harassment, bullying and threats.

Deceptive use — misleading people about who owns the code; creating codes using someone else's brand, logo or identity; changing a code's destination with intent to deceive.

Note: Changing a destination later is a normal, legitimate feature (updating a campaign, changing a menu). What is prohibited is deliberately using it to deceive — for instance showing a harmless page during review and a harmful one afterwards.

Technical abuse — creating excessive load with automated tools, attempting to bypass security measures, attempting to access other users' codes, or using the service to distribute spam.

Google policy violations — review gating, where customers likely to leave a low rating are filtered out and only satisfied ones are sent to Google, is neither offered nor permitted. It breaches Google's policies and misleads consumers.

2. Monitoring

Every new destination is automatically checked against Google Safe Browsing when saved. Suspicious destinations trigger a warning interstitial before the redirect. We do not systematically scan content; we act on reports and automated check results.

3. Reporting and enforcement

Report violations at qrkarekod.com/kotuye-kullanim — the short code is enough. Where a report is upheld, the code is disabled and scanners see a safety notice, the owner is notified and given a right of appeal, repeated or serious violations lead to account closure, and criminal matters are referred to the competent authorities.

Immediate action: phishing, malware and child sexual abuse content result in the code being disabled at once, without prior notice.

Appeals: if you believe your code was disabled unfairly, write to destek@qrkarekod.com. Appeals are reviewed within 5 business days.

4. Intermediary status

qrkarekod.com is an intermediary service provider under Turkish Law No. 6563 and a hosting provider under Law No. 5651. We are not obliged to review user-generated content before publication, but we are obliged to remove content once unlawfulness is notified to us.
